  6. #2506
    Quote Originally Posted by Aqira91 View Post
    i have a few question about boomkin in beta/ptr. so snapshoting is gone so far as i know it. But the eclipse bar do that snapp shot or do we just put up each dot and they get auto boosted ?

    so as far as instants go, do we have any of the sort now? for like moving. seeing as starsurge aint instant any more.

    talents, do we still prefer incarnation? also am not sure if gift of the wild still gives us any bonus stats but is it still the best?

    sry for bad spelling
    Snapshotting is gone, yes. Eclipse energy is dynamic now like every other stat, but there are specific times you will want to cast Moon/Sunfire to maximize the damage of other spells and the DoT's uptime.

    Our instants are Starsurge (at lvl 100 with leveling perk), Moonfire, Sunfire and Starfall.

    Not sure on the cd talents since FoN got a buff recently and I don't know how Incarnation compares to SotF on single-target.

    Heart of the Wild has no passive stats now. Nature's Vigil will be our "default" choice there.

  10. #2510
    Deleted
    Well it's gonna depend on a couple of things. Like you mentioned, leveling perks, but other than that also lv 100 talents (for instance dks gain barely anything from those, while mages gain a pretty big increase) and there is scaling with secondary stats. Since most classes are tuned to have pretty low amounts of secondary stats for the first tier, this should cause a pretty huge imbalance during 6.0.2 (for instance dks usually scale like shit). For boomkins in particular a major problem will be the huge amounts of crit on gear since spirit/hit on gear turns into crit > haste. We will have way higher crit chance than anytime during WoD because in the last tier of WoD we will have 2 extra secondary stats, and we wont go for crit on gear anyway. That means we'll probably have some issues with spending all our SS charges in time w/o wasting emp buffs.
